Essises (French pronunciation: [esiz]) is a commune in the Aisne department in Hauts-de-France in northern France.

Historical population
YearPop.±% p.a.
1968 203—    
1975 177−1.94%
1982 239+4.38%
1990 325+3.92%
1999 370+1.45%
2007 423+1.69%
2012 433+0.47%
2017 417−0.75%
2023 399−0.73%
Source: INSEE[3]
